Hey dpowell,
Never heard of the problem you're having. The cause
could be one of these:
- The vf-1 could be too close to your amp.
Especially tube amps are known for their magnetic coupling to other devices,
because they ;operate at high voltages, high power and are full of
transformers
- You sure you hooked it up correctly? If you
somehow connect the vf-1's input to its own output, it'll cry like a baby. Even
if only a tiny part of the output comes back into the input. If you're using the
unit in an effects loop, try using it in a preamp type setup and
see.

----- Original Message -----From: dug d gravesSent: Sunday, October 07, 2001 8:48 AMSubject: [BossVF1] feedbackhey there,
i just got a vf-1 and i'm using it live on stage as a guitar processor. i have a big problem with feedback. i'm getting really high end feedback and it's really ugly sounding, not like normal guitar feedback. i've changed different pieces of my setup just to make sure of the problem, and it seems to be the processor. anyone had any similar experience? anyone got any suggestions?
